Walnut-Pineapple Shrikand

Ingredients

  • 2 cups - hung curds (hung for 20-24 hours)
  • 2 slices - canned pineapple, drained, crushed
  • 2 - walnuts, shelled, finely chopped
  • 1/2 cup - sugar, powdered, sieved
  • 1/4 tsp - cardamom powder
  • 1 drop - pineapple essence
  • For Garnishing:
  • Pineapple bits
  • Walnut halves or quarters

How to Make Walnut-Pineapple Shrikand

  • Make sure curds are very stiff. Beat smooth with an egg beater in a large bowl.
  • Sprinkle sugar, cardamom and essence and beat again to mix well.
  • Press out any extra syrup from crushed pineapple and add to curds.
  • Add walnuts, fold in gently and mix well.
  • Take in serving bowl and decorate with pieces of pineapple and walnut.
  • Chill for 2-3 hours before serving.
  • Refrigerate at all times.
